Generally, shorter fighters tend to be wrestlers. How many successful striking specialist have been short or have shorter reach?
Note: I am not including fighters who use their wrestling to setup their strikes.
So the following are not applicable
- Demetrious Johnson
- Frankie Edgar
- Kelvin Gastelum
- Georges St. Pierre
1. Lineker
- Lineker is a pretty small guy even for the Bantamweight division, yet he relies a lot on closing distance and boxing with his opponents. He has found success due to his incredible chin and solid power.
2. Cody Garbrant
- Cody isn't short for his division, but his reach is 64.8, which is a pretty small reach for his division. He makes up for this by incorporating close range hooks and head movement, as well as great balance on his strikes.
